Patna, Oct 15 (PTI) Several leaders of the Congress, including its state president, got tickets for the assembly polls in Bihar on Wednesday, when the leadership also contended with backlash from disgruntled elements and tried to iron out differences with allies.

Although the party has not yet come out with a list of candidates, several aspirants stormed the Patna airport late in the evening, to heckle state Congress president Rajesh Kumar and legislative party leader Shakil Ahmed Khan, accusing them of having “put up tickets for sale”.
